**Q: Why does the Fernwick kiosk watchdog restart the app even when the UI looks responsive?**

A: The watchdog checks a heartbeat file written by the render loop, not screen output. If the loop stalls for 45 seconds—commonly during a blocked network call on the payment screen—the watchdog force-restarts regardless of visual state. We discussed loosening this at last week's sync; the current timing rationale is documented here:

wiki page, bagaf-fawip: https://harbor.tolvaqsys.local/pages/repo/pages/secrets/eac969ffc71f356b

Ticket GUIDE-412: The nightly build of the Wexhall Museum audio-guide app (Echowalk v3.2) failed its signature check on the distribution pipeline. The failure started after Tuesday's CI runner migration; the keystore path was copied but the alias apparently wasn't. Builds are blocked for both the Gallery Mode and Kids Tour variants. Marta confirmed the store listing is unaffected since nothing shipped. To unblock the release branch before Friday, re-sign with the current production key, reproduced here for the sync notes.

signing key of bagap-yawep = bky13_TbfT6ZMUoGJo2

**Ticket FWC-88: Promote beta firmware channel to stable**

Plugin authors targeting the Ottervane device line: channel promotion is blocked pending sign-off. The 3.4 firmware changes the plugin manifest schema; untested plugins may fail validation on update. Pin your SDK to 3.3 until the stable channel flips. Rollout freeze is in effect. No merges to the channel config until approval lands. Sign-off is required from the release owner named below.

named custodian: Oliath Ralax